CC -!- COFACTOR:
CC Name=a divalent metal cation; Xref=ChEBI:CHEBI:60240;
CC Evidence={ECO:0000256|RuleBase:RU363067};
CC Note=Binds 2 divalent metal cations per subunit. Site 1 may
CC preferentially bind zinc ions, while site 2 has a preference for
CC magnesium and/or manganese ions. {ECO:0000256|RuleBase:RU363067};
CC -!- SIMILARITY: Belongs to the cyclic nucleotide phosphodiesterase family.
CC {ECO:0000256|RuleBase:RU363067}.
